Tell your Story
It’s vital to let customers see your strength – so tell
your story – this is the leading piece of advice from Nigel Gahan of Gahan
Meats in the Business section of the Irish Independent. Nigel has worked in the family meat business
in Dublin for 20 years. He says that so
many companies have great stories but they keep it to themselves. His other recommendations include: Delegate;
Focus; Recognise your Strengths & Weaknesses - and it is all about Customer Service…..
Make money from your Blog
7 tips on how to make money from your Blog from Ian Cleary
of Razor Social – my favourite social media and online marketing guru as he
really knows his stuff and speaks in plain English – not teccie speak! With each of the tips, Ian recommends some
tools and websites you can use. The tips
include: running webinars, promoting other content, doing product reviews and
selling your own products. See here for
